Entitled the "Citizen's Tax Protection Amendment", proposing an amendment to the Constitution of the United States to prohibit retroactive taxation.

Introduced: August 3, 1993 See on congress.gov
This bill died when the 103rd Congress ended
It never became law before the 103rd Congress (1993–1994) adjourned, and bills don't carry over to the next Congress. It would have to be reintroduced. You can still save it for reference, but it won't receive updates.

 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Constitutional Amendment - Prohibits Congress from passing a law with retroactive taxes or fees.
